Possible Causes of Water Damage in New Market

Water damage in homes and businesses in New Market often results from various unforeseen events. One common cause is burst or leaking pipes, which can happen due to aging plumbing, freezing temperatures, or sudden pipe failures. These leaks can lead to significant water intrusion, damaging floors, walls, and personal belongings if not addressed promptly.

Another frequent culprit is weather-related incidents, such as heavy rainfall or hurricanes, which can overwhelm drainage systems and cause water to enter a property. Flooding can also be caused by appliance malfunctions, like overflowing washing machines or water heaters. Regardless of the source, immediate action is essential to minimize structural damage and prevent mold growth.

Will the water damage affect my property’s foundation?

Yes, standing water and excessive moisture can weaken a building’s foundation over time. That’s why prompt water extraction and thorough drying are critical. Our experts evaluate foundation risks during our assessment and take necessary steps to protect your property.

What should I do before your team arrives?

If possible, turn off the water source and remove any valuables from the affected areas. Keep access clear for our technicians and avoid attempting to dry or clean the water yourself, as improper handling can cause further damage. Call us at (256) 485-6233 for immediate assistance.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Regular maintenance of plumbing and appliances, proper drainage, and timely repairs can reduce the risk of water intrusion. Installing sump pumps and improving landscaping drainage can also help prevent flooding. If you experience a water emergency, contact our experts immediately for professional intervention.
